(Pocket-lint) - As of in the present day, choose Superchargers in France and Noway will start working with non-Tesla electrical autos.
Eligible areas will be considered within the Tesla app and it seems that at present there are 20 areas in France and 15 in Norway.
Again in November, Tesla started opening up its Supercharger community to permit entry to third-party EVs. This system was launched initially with 10 Supercharger stations throughout the Netherlands.
If you wish to reap the benefits of the pilot program, it is at present out there to EV drivers based mostly within the Netherlands, Norway, Germany, France and Belgium.
After all, Tesla homeowners can use the stations as regular however CCS-enabled autos may also have the ability to make use of the chargers.
Tesla said, in a weblog publish, that non-Tesla EVs might want to pay extra charges to "assist charging a broad vary of autos and changes to our websites to accommodate these autos."
Tesla additionally mentioned that it is going to be monitoring congestion at every web site included in this system and that future enlargement relies on capability.
The publish states that it has lengthy been an ambition to open Supercharger websites to different EVs as higher charging infrastructure will encourage extra drivers to go for EVs.
One other big profit is that "extra prospects utilizing the Supercharger community permits quicker enlargement."
If the pilot proves profitable, it feels like excellent news for all EV homeowners, Tesla or not.
